How Inmate Care Package Services for Colorado State Prisons and Jails Actually Works

Inmate care package services for Colorado State Prisons and Jails typically begin with understanding facility-specific regulations. Each prison and jail in Colorado maintains a list of allowed items, approved vendors, and rules about contents, pricing, and shipping. Families usually start by contacting the facility’s administration or visiting its official website for current guidelines. Once clear on what is permitted, they can choose between direct shopping, curated packages, or subscription-based options that simplify regular support. Most services handle packaging, labeling, and compliance checks so items arrive without delays or rejections.

For example, a care package might include approved snacks, stationery, stamps, personal care products, and educational books tailored to the facility’s rules. Colorado facilities often require items to be in original packaging, with no metal, wire, or prohibited materials. Some services offer themed packages for birthdays or holidays, while others focus on consistent monthly support that helps maintain routine. By coordinating with commissary systems and mailrooms, these services reduce confusion for both senders and recipients. The process emphasizes safety, transparency, and reliability, which helps build trust among families navigating the correctional system.

What items are actually allowed in care packages for Colorado prisons and jails?

Allowed items vary by facility, but most Colorado prisons and jails permit basic hygiene products, non-perishable snacks, stamps, envelopes, and certain stationery. Many services provide detailed lists that specify brand restrictions, quantity limits, and packaging requirements. Items with metal components, cords, or unknown materials are commonly prohibited for security reasons. It is essential to check the specific rules of each institution before sending anything.

Things People Often Misunderstand About Inmate Care Package Services for Colorado State Prisons and Jails

A common misconception is that any item can be sent as long as it is purchased legally. In reality, correctional facilities enforce strict standards to ensure safety, and even everyday products can be rejected if they do not meet specific guidelines. Another misunderstanding is that all packages move quickly through the system, when in fact security reviews and processing times can cause delays. Some people assume that larger or more expensive packages show greater care, but facility rules may actually limit quantities or restrict certain categories entirely. Understanding these realities helps families avoid disappointment and align their efforts with institutional priorities.
